SCOUTS Australia have installed their 1000th water tank as part of the largest community water saving project ever undertaken.
At the completion of the project Scouts will have installed more than 1100 water tanks at Scout locations right across Australia. Noble Park Scouts are one of the many who have taken part in the project fully funded by the Federal Government.
Scout leader Dot said the best way to educate Scouts about the benefits of water saving was by applying a practical water savings project.
